From 685b8ec16826b735883a7d758dfbbac27f5a2a7b Mon Sep 17 00:00:00 2001 From: Rob Gries Date: Tue, 29 Jan 2019 22:58:50 -0500 Subject: [PATCH] Beta fixes (#21) * Fix network error string and autosize text * Allow android studio to build signed release --- .gitignore | 6 +++++- app/build.gradle | 12 +++++++++++- 2 files changed, 16 insertions(+), 2 deletions(-) diff --git a/.gitignore b/.gitignore index 3c117df..8d62573 100644 --- a/.gitignore +++ b/.gitignore @@ -1,6 +1,7 @@ # Built application files *.apk *.ap_ +*.aab # Files for the ART/Dalvik VM *.dex @@ -62,4 +63,7 @@ fastlane/report.xml fastlane/Preview.html fastlane/screenshots fastlane/test_output -fastlane/readme.md \ No newline at end of file +fastlane/readme.md + +# keystores +*.jks diff --git a/app/build.gradle b/app/build.gradle index 7c2f1ae..c40f31a 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-9,6 +9,14 @@ apply plugin: 'kotlin-kapt' apply plugin: 'kotlinx-serialization' android { + signingConfigs { + config { + storeFile file(store_file) + storePassword store_password + keyAlias key_alias + keyPassword key_password + } + } compileOptions { sourceCompatibility JavaVersion.VERSION_1_8 targetCompatibility JavaVersion.VERSION_1_8 @@ -28,11 +36,13 @@ android { buildTypes { debug { resValue 'string', "api_key", pantries_android_maps_key + signingConfig signingConfigs.config } release { minifyEnabled false pro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ro' resValue 'string', "api_key", pantries_android_maps_key + signingConfig signingConfigs.config } } } @@ -51,7 +61,7 @@ repositories { } dependencies { - implementation fileTree(dir: 'libs', include: ['*.jar']) + implementation fileTree(include: ['*.jar'], dir: 'libs') implementation "android.arch.lifecycle:extensions:$lifecycle_version" implementation "org.jetbrains.kotlin:kotlin-stdlib-jdk7:$kotlin_version" implementation "org.jetbrains.kotlinx:kotlinx-coroutines-android:$coroutines_version"